What is Healthcare SaaS Application Development?
Healthcare SaaS App Development refers to building of cloud powered custom healthcare applications that can be accessed seamlessly by web and mobile apps anywhere without any complex or heavy hardware installations. With the healthcare SaaS applications, there is much flexibility, faster updates, enhanced security, & improved scalability.
In spite of buying & maintaining any kind of traditional/on-prem approach, organizations nowadays utilize SaaS development to create flexible, subscription-based tools like the telemedicine platforms, effective EHR systems, appointment scheduling systems, and also remote patient dashboards. This approach makes developing a healthcare SaaS application much more efficient, future-ready, and aligned with the real-time clinical process.
With the healthcare SaaS applications, organizations can get benefits from mobile accessibility for clinicians and patients, faster feature rollouts, enhanced security, and better scalability. Global Healthcare SaaS Market: Trends, Opportunities, and Growth Forecast
The global healthcare software market size was estimated at $25.3 billion in 2024, and is projected to grow to $74.7 billion by 2030, with a CAGR of 20% from 2025-2030. This indicates great adoption of cloud computing, the need for the cost effective solutions, and also the growing demand for the remote based healthcare solutions, which is quite impressive in the arena of the healthcare space.
The transformative shift of healthcare is supported by government initiatives, and technological advancements are driving the growth of SaaS solutions. Additionally, there is a rise in patient engagement, data security concerns, and the need for streamlined healthcare management that tends to contribute to market expansion. Key Challenges for Healthcare SaaS Development
The healthcare SaaS market is brimming with potential, but there are challenges while you build and scale. Starting from protecting your sensitive data to seamless adoption by the service providers, there are various hurdles that need to be overcome while healthcare SaaS products are evolving and on the way to the development stage.
- Data Security & Standard Compliance System
Protecting patient information is one of the core tasks in the aspect of healthcare SaaS development. The healthcare platforms must comply with the stringent regulations like HIPAA, GDPR, and various other data privacy laws. This means embedding compliance into the software architecture, not just layering it afterward. There should be proper implementation of strong encryption, robust access controls, and also continuous auditing that tends to meet the requirements and builds trustability.
- Interoperability with Legacy System
Healthcare organizations generally rely on the path of legacy systems, starting from EHR to billing systems, which doesn’t convey the same thing. So, ensuring a SaaS product can share the data seamlessly across fragmented systems is often said to be a technical challenge.
- Scalability & Performance Considerations
The healthcare environments generate vast amounts of healthcare data and various other related information for the clinicians, administrators, patient and other patients. A SaaS platform must handle higher throughput without any latency,which calls for resilient architectures. Without this, performance bottlenecks can degrade the overall user experience and also limit the adoption process.

How to Build a Successful Healthcare SaaS Application?
Here’s how most of the organization’s approach is towards building a healthcare SaaS application that has high potential.
- Market Research & Competitive Analysis
With every potential healthcare SaaS application development journey, there is a greater understanding of the landscape in the healthcare segment. This involves analyzing the patient's needs, the healthcare workflow, competitor products & emerging digital health trends. Also, it is important to identify the gaps in SaaS applications in healthcare, whether in usability, compliance, or speed.
The three core areas of research that surround the development of a healthcare SaaS application are
- Market Research Study
- Competitor’s Research Study
- Customers/Users’ Research Study
With this step, you will find the answer to many questions like;
- What is the overall current market size?
- What are the customer pain points?
- Does your market need a new Saas healthcare product?
- What makes your SaaS healthcare platform different from others?
- Defining Requirements & Plan Architecture
So, once the market overview and research have been completed, the next step is to translate all the insights into some functional and essential requirements like user roles, essential features, data handling aspects, and also the standard compliance.
With a scalable cloud architecture, it has been ensured that the custom healthcare SaaS application can manage the user modules in the future and also establish proper data growth. At this phase, there is also a need for several significant things that include tech stack selection, hosting plans, API strategies, and interoperability frameworks, which are quite crucial for developing a healthcare SaaS application that remains long-term adaptable.
